Bright Light Academy

About Our School

Bright Light Academy has been providing high quality education to the greater Pittsburgh area since 2016. We are dedicated to maintaining the highest standards possible, and by doing so have been a Keystone Stars Star 4 Child Care Center since 2021. Why Join Our Team?

As an early childcare education provider, we understand the importance of investing in our staff. That's why we offer professional development classes and training opportunities to help you grow both personally and professionally. We also provide first aid and CPR courses to ensure the safety of both our staff and children. In addition, we understand that background checks and clearances can be costly, which is why we can reimburse those expenses following a staff members successful completion of a probationary period.
At Bright Light Academy, our teachers are seen as team members, and we value our staff as individuals with lives outside of work. We believe that a positive work-life balance is essential to creating a healthy and happy workplace environment. BRIGHT LIGHT ACADEMY'S VISION

      In a world where families are pulled in so many different directions it can seem like our youngest children are often an afterthought. When the “race to the top” often leaves those same children at the bottom of a “to do” list. When it is easier to shut yourself off from our neighbors than getting to know them. When family dinners have been replaced with take-out on the way to or from soccer, dance or baseball. When more time is spent interfacing with a machine than with people & more environmental toxins are affecting both our short & long-term health, we feel there is a need to get back to basics. 
     We strive to provide an environmentally friendly, healthy & safe atmosphere to every child regardless of economic barriers, encouraging not only academic growth but social-emotional learning as well. Through a variety of activities & experiences we help grow not only life-long learners, but caring, responsible citizens. By embracing all of the culture, diversity & events our community has to offer, we can expose our students to a variety of opportunities they might not otherwise get to enjoy. When we take the focus off the group & put it onto the individual child, we can better serve their individual needs to assist them in reaching their maximum potential. 
   We endeavor to make our center a warm, welcoming environment where we can assist our parents with not only their childcare needs, but also in offering opportunities for them to come together as a family and as a community to have fun, learn or just enjoy time in their child’s classroom. We hope to offer the support every parent needs as they go through life’s many struggles & we are honored to be a part of our families’ community. 
     We hope to be a place where teachers are appreciated and valued as equal contributors to a larger goal, where teamwork is the norm and not the exception, and where lifetime friendships are built. We aspire to be a safe haven from the rough, busy, messy world outside where everyone has a place and where children, families and teachers come to stay because they are part of our family.
